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ows can increase the energy efficiency of your home. They can lower your energy bills by reducing the transfer of heat from your home to other properties. This will make your home more comfortable in the winter months and cooler in summer, meaning you don't have to rely as much on heating or air cooling systems. You'll save money on your gas and electricity bills.

A double-glazed window comprises two glass panes which are separated by an air gap. They are then filled with insulating gas such as argon or krypton. They are more energy efficient than single-paned windows due to this type of insulation. The type of glass you choose for your double-glazed windows can also affect the efficiency of your energy bill. There are a variety of types of low-emissivity glass, with varying levels of visible light transmittance (VLT). The VLT is measured by an angle of 0deg. It also reflects infrared long-wave heat from the sun. The lower the VLT is the lower, the less heat your windows will get from the sun.

Another factor that determines thermal performance of double glazed windows is their U value, which is a measure of how easily the window conducts heat. The lower the U value, the better the insulating properties of the window. Double-glazed windows with a low U value will keep heat in during colder months and out during warmer seasons.

Security

Double glazing is far more resistant to break than single glass panes and can resist the force of bricks being thrown at them. The gap that is insulating between the panes makes it difficult for burglars to gain entry into your home through windows. The gaps are so narrow that you can still enjoy plenty of sunlight.

Double-glazed windows can reduce condensation in older homes. Condensation occurs when air inside a house meets the cold glass of a window, causing dampness that gives furniture and carpets an unpleasant smell and promote mildew spores to grow. Double glazing means that the warm air will never meet the cold glass, and condensation isn't a possibility.

Noise reduction

If you're looking to have a tranquil and comfortable living space, without the distraction of noise pollution from neighbors or outside traffic, double glazing could aid. A standard window with one pane of glass allows in a lot of noise however a double-glazed unit, also known as an IGU is equipped with an additional layer of glass and an air gap that reduces the transmission of sound. This allows for an STC rating between 28 and 32. This makes a double glazing repairs near me glazed windows near me the ideal option for homes in areas with a lot of noise.

UV protection

Double glazing is a well-known and cost-effective upgrade for all types of homes. They can reduce your energy costs, create an energised and peaceful home, and can even boost the value of your home. Not all double-glazed windows are identical. The type of glass used, the size of the gap between the panes of glass and the quantity of gas or vacuum in the gaps will all affect the performance and price of the window. It can be difficult to find the top double-glazed windows around me but the effort is worth it.

A double-glazed window near me with UV protection can significantly reduce harmful UV radiations that enter your home. These rays can damage furniture, carpets, and artwork. UV rays are known to cause skin cancers, and it is important to shield your family and yourself from them as much as is possible. Double-glazed windows with UV protection can help by blocking 99 percent of harmful UV rays.
